Sobes.tech
Назад к вопросам
Junior — Middle
62

Каким образом осуществляется формирование индекса в системе хранения данных?

Ответ от нейросети

sobes.tech AI

Формирование индекса в системе хранения данных обычно включает следующие шаги:

  1. Выбор ключа индексации: определяется, по каким полям или атрибутам будет строиться индекс.
  2. Построение структуры данных: создаётся структура (например, B-дерево, хеш-таблица), которая позволяет быстро находить записи по ключу.
  3. Сканирование данных: система проходит по существующим данным и добавляет записи в индекс согласно выбранному ключу.
  4. Обновление индекса: при добавлении, изменении или удалении данных индекс обновляется, чтобы оставаться актуальным.

Пример: в Java с использованием базы данных можно создать индекс на поле таблицы, чтобы ускорить поиск. Внутри СУБД индекс реализуется как отдельная структура, которая хранит ссылки на записи, отсортированные по ключу.

Таким образом, индекс — это дополнительная структура, которая ускоряет операции поиска за счёт хранения упорядоченной информации о данных.